Foundation knowledge refers to the essential concepts, skills, and information that form the basis for further learning and understanding in a particular subject or field. It includes fundamental principles and theories that learners must grasp to build upon in more advanced studies. This foundational understanding is crucial for effective problem-solving and application of knowledge in practical contexts. In education, ensuring students have a solid foundation can significantly enhance their ability to engage with complex topics later on.
A shallow foundation is generally considered any foundation element that is 6 feet or less in depth. or the depth of foundation is equals to its width of the foundation. Examples are thickened edge slabs and grade beams that are supporting minimal weight.
Well foundation is the most commonly adopted foundation for major bridges in India. Since then many major bridges across wide rivers have been founded on wells. Well foundation is preferable to pile foundation when foundation has to resist large lateral forces.

An elastic foundation is a foundation that is not rigid and follows Hook's law. The implications of an analysis on an elastic foundation are that you can no longer assume zero deflection from at the base of loaded structures.
